This 6-storey hotel was built in 2003 and comprises a total of 168 double rooms and 4 suites. Amongst the facilities count a foyer with a 24-hour reception desk, lifts, a bar, an air-conditioned restaurant and a public Internet terminal (for an additional fee). Those arriving by car may make use of the garage and there is a play area for younger guests. The lobby is large and modern in its appearance.
Lying to the south of the Thames, this hotel lies close to the centre of London where there are countless shopping and entertainment venues. The nearest underground station is London Bridge, which is about 2 minutes from the hotel.
Guests may select their breakfast from an ample buffet.